    "Fernspray' is used as a synomyn for C. obtusa 'Filicoides' sometimes, not sure if that is the plant in the photo though. Also a 'Filicoides Compacta' referred to as 'Fernspray Cypress', and then 'Compact Fernspray'. Can be a little confusing with multiple names used, a closeup photo may help.
